Glenwood, IN is a small rural town located in the Midwest region of the United States. The community is made up of about 2,500 residents and is surrounded by rolling hills and plenty of green space. The schools in Glenwood are well regarded as providing excellent educational opportunities to their students. The local school district consists of four public schools: a high school, an elementary school, a middle school, and an alternative education center that caters to students with special needs. Each school has its own unique rating from the Indiana Department of Education; these ratings range from exemplary to acceptable and provide parents with information about the quality of instruction at each institution. All four schools have shown steady improvement over the years, making them strong contenders for top-tier public schools in Indiana. The staff at each school work tirelessly to ensure every student receives a quality education that prepares them for college or other career paths.
